Safety First: Tips for a Secure Craigslist Experience
Now, let's get real, guys. While Craigslist Fountain Valley California is an amazing tool, safety is paramount. We all want to score great deals and connect with our community, but we need to do it smartly. The internet, even the local version of Craigslist, can have its risks, so let's talk about how to stay safe. When you're meeting someone to buy or sell an item, always prioritize public and well-lit locations. Think busy shopping center parking lots during the day, or the lobby of a police station if they offer such facilities. Avoid meeting at your home or the seller's home, especially if it's your first interaction. Bring a friend along if possible; there's safety in numbers. Never share sensitive personal information like your bank account details, social security number, or home address unless absolutely necessary and you've established a high level of trust (which is rare on initial Craigslist interactions). Be wary of any seller or buyer who insists on unusual payment methods or asks for upfront payment for items that aren't yet delivered or inspected. Cash is often king for in-person transactions, but be cautious about carrying large amounts. If you're selling something valuable, consider meeting at a location where you can have someone else present. For online communications, keep your conversations within the Craigslist messaging system for as long as possible. If you move to texting or email, be mindful of what information you're revealing. Report any suspicious activity, harassment, or scams to Craigslist immediately. They have systems in place to deal with this, and reporting helps keep the platform safer for everyone. Trust your gut; if a deal seems too good to be true, or a person makes you feel uncomfortable, it's probably best to walk away. A great deal isn't worth risking your personal safety or security.
